Eric and Courtney are driving with the boys and the babies, they are going to the zoo. It is the babies first time at the zoo, Gerry and Ramona and aunt Courtney are there to help out. They see a sloth and Courtney says she would do anything to be a sloth for a day. River is getting tired, one of the boys tries to sit with her and she bites him. Overall, the trip was difficult.

Back at home, Eric and Courtney talk about the boys wanting to go to karate. Courtney tells Eric she thinks the babies should go to preschool. Eric agrees, they are having trouble talking and it will help.

Danielle has this idea about the family moving into a mobile home, Eric doesn’t think it is too promising of a situation for them. Danielle thinks they should stay on property, it will be much easier for them overall. Time for the boys’ basketball practice, Eric feels blessed that he gets to coach them. Eric tells the boys that they are signed up for a trial karate lesson to see how they like it.

Kayleigh, Emily, and Valerie drop by to help with the kids. Kayleigh tells Courtney that she wants the babies at her wedding. Courtney tells them about putting the babies in preschool.

The boys are out playing soccer, its time to go to look at mobile homes. Courtney tells Eric that the pre-school has accepted the babies. They meet with a man named Brian, he is shocked that they have six babies. Courtney is the only one excited about this new adventure. They look at one, and both agree that it is too small. They look at a second, it is 1500 square feet and looks like it would be doable, according to Courtney. Eric finally gives in to Courtney, they agree to the larger mobile home.

Time for the karate try-out lesson, they are all dressed in their karate outfits, Courtney and Eric are watching. Courtney tells Eric maybe they should take a class, let off some steam and kick some things. Eric tells Courtney that they are going to have to talk to the boys, if they want to do karate, they are going to have to give up basketball.

It’s the first day of preschool, Courtney is trying to get them all dressed and ready to go. They arrive at the school, Miss Sandy comes out to welcome them. Eric is there, Courtney is really emotional, even though she is trying to upbeat and positive. The children are in the classroom, Eric says the boys are going to give the teachers a run for their money. Eric and Courtney leave, Courtney watches from around the corner and sees the girls crying. Courtney can’t believe this is the first time in the babies’ lives that she has been all alone, she is driving back home.

Courtney is home, she is cleaning upstairs, it looks like the toys exploded. Valerie drops by, Courtney tells her that this mess is last night’s play. Courtney starts crying, she misses the babies, but she knows this is best for them, they need to socialize. She just wants to hear how their day was, and she hopes it wasn’t too traumatic. Courtney returns to the school to pick them up, they had a good day. Courtney gets them all packed up in the track, Eric calls, she lets him know that they had a great day. Courtney feels the day was worth it, this is good for the babies.

Mealtime, Eric tells the boys that if they go to karate, they will have to quit something else. The boys are not willing to give up the other sports that they have done for years. Eric tells them that they can do karate for a few months, but when baseball season starts, they will have to make a decision. Courtney asks Eric to go outside with her, she thought of a place to put the mobile home.
